atom feed57 messages in org.xwiki.usersRe: [xwiki-users] [xwiki-devs] [Prop...
FromSent OnAttachments
Ecaterina ValicaMay 10, 2010 6:39 am 
Guillaume LerougeMay 10, 2010 7:01 am 
Ecaterina ValicaMay 10, 2010 7:07 am 
Thomas MortagneMay 10, 2010 8:21 am 
Ecaterina ValicaMay 13, 2010 1:56 am 
Ecaterina ValicaMay 18, 2010 2:03 am 
Guillaume LerougeMay 18, 2010 8:07 am 
Denis GervalleMay 18, 2010 8:28 am 
Ecaterina ValicaMay 19, 2010 3:23 am 
Ecaterina ValicaMay 19, 2010 3:39 am 
Denis GervalleMay 19, 2010 6:52 am 
Ecaterina ValicaMay 19, 2010 7:32 am 
Ecaterina ValicaMay 20, 2010 9:17 am 
Guillaume LerougeMay 20, 2010 9:21 am 
Ecaterina ValicaMay 21, 2010 10:51 am 
Alex BuseniusMay 21, 2010 11:41 am 
Ecaterina ValicaMay 21, 2010 10:57 pm 
Denis GervalleMay 22, 2010 1:31 am 
Ecaterina ValicaMay 26, 2010 6:48 am 
Ecaterina ValicaMay 27, 2010 12:57 am 
Denis GervalleMay 27, 2010 1:25 am 
Ecaterina ValicaMay 31, 2010 7:53 am 
Ecaterina ValicaMay 31, 2010 7:54 am 
Denis GervalleJun 1, 2010 12:03 am 
Ecaterina ValicaJun 1, 2010 3:54 am 
Ecaterina ValicaJun 3, 2010 9:08 am 
Denis GervalleJun 4, 2010 12:42 am 
Ecaterina ValicaJun 4, 2010 9:54 am 
Alex BuseniusJun 4, 2010 10:56 am 
Ecaterina ValicaJun 4, 2010 11:23 am 
Raluca StavroJun 4, 2010 11:33 am 
Raluca StavroJun 4, 2010 11:36 am 
Alex BuseniusJun 4, 2010 12:04 pm 
Denis GervalleJun 4, 2010 3:53 pm 
Ecaterina ValicaJun 7, 2010 1:22 am 
Ecaterina ValicaJun 7, 2010 1:50 am 
Denis GervalleJun 7, 2010 2:23 am 
Ecaterina ValicaJun 7, 2010 7:59 am 
Ecaterina ValicaJun 8, 2010 2:19 am 
Denis GervalleJun 8, 2010 3:46 am 
Raluca StavroJun 8, 2010 4:44 am 
Ecaterina ValicaJun 8, 2010 6:40 am 
Denis GervalleJun 8, 2010 8:13 am 
Philip BrunettiJun 8, 2010 6:53 pm 
Caleb James DeLisleJun 8, 2010 7:31 pm 
Vincent MassolJun 9, 2010 12:24 am 
Sergiu DumitriuJun 9, 2010 2:56 am 
Ecaterina ValicaJun 9, 2010 3:23 am 
Ecaterina ValicaJun 9, 2010 3:35 am 
Sergiu DumitriuJun 9, 2010 3:45 am 
Sergiu DumitriuJun 9, 2010 5:01 am 
Sergiu DumitriuJun 9, 2010 5:04 am 
Raluca StavroJun 9, 2010 8:28 am 
Raluca StavroJun 9, 2010 8:29 am 
Raluca StavroJun 9, 2010 8:31 am 
Ecaterina ValicaJun 9, 2010 10:11 am 
Denis GervalleJun 10, 2010 12:15 am 
Subject:Re: [xwiki-users] [xwiki-devs] [Proposal] Rights Management UI
From:Ecaterina Valica (vali@gmail.com)
Date:Jun 8, 2010 6:40:39 am
List:org.xwiki.users

On Tue, Jun 8, 2010 at 13:46, Denis Gervalle <dg@softec.lu> wrote:

On Tue, Jun 8, 2010 at 11:19, Ecaterina Valica <vali@gmail.com> wrote:

On Tue, Jun 8, 2010 at 09:01, Denis Gervalle <dg@softec.lu> wrote:

On Mon, Jun 7, 2010 at 17:00, Ecaterina Valica <vali@gmail.com> wrote:

It will if it display the inheritance source in a column. For right

set

at

current level this column could even precise what inheritance has been overwritten, both in terms of allowance and origin.

Hi Denis,

"Something" like this:

http://incubator.myxwiki.org/xwiki/bin/view/Improvements/Rights51Space

Yes, "something" like that. I would have expected a "back to basic" button in place of "advanced, and the removal of the basic interface to avoid duplicating basic rights. Maybe the menu should be horizontal in the advanced interface, I do not know. Also add some hyperlinks to upper level in the column explaining inheritance. And put the highlight of changes over the rest of the row (includes name and inheritance)

http://incubator.myxwiki.org/xwiki/bin/view/Improvements/Rights51Space

About:

I would have expected a "back to basic" button in place of "advanced, and the removal of the basic interface to avoid duplicating basic rights

http://incubator.myxwiki.org/xwiki/bin/download/Improvements/Rights43Proposal/rights52Space.png

This removal of the basic interface will be set from the user profile's variables (if it has advanced type)?

No, just removed when the advanced interface is shown using the advanced button, like you have done.

I mean if the user is advanced, all the rows will be presented in advances?

No, the only thing I proposed is that user that are not set "Advanced user" in their profile, will not be presented the advanced interface link, and will never see extended rights.

I'm asking because I think the collapsed view is great to see changes up in the table, where you don't care the advanced status of those rights.

I completely agree. Advanced interface is for understanding and fixing deep complex stuffs

WDYT ? Is this interesting ?

it's nice :P I would love to see some other opinions.

Yes, could it be possible for you to fix the interactive version to hide the basics and also to have hover and click work as expected. I think it will helps in receiving more feed back with causing confusion.

Raluca offered to help me fix the interaction.

I found the result really well suited now. There is just some improvement in color contrast, icons aspect, and so on that should be applied if we get approval for this proposal.

Once you have fixed the sample, I think that a summary page (resume of our reflexion, and containing only the final proposal) and than a vote thread could be appropriate to receive feedback from other committers, since the size of this thread could be pushing back.

Yes, a summary+vote is needed.

I made a version with pagination and filters added. http://incubator.myxwiki.org/xwiki/bin/view/Improvements/Rights51Space

PNG for the filters: collapsed: http://incubator.myxwiki.org/xwiki/bin/download/Improvements/Rights43Proposal/filtersCollapsed.png expanded: http://incubator.myxwiki.org/xwiki/bin/download/Improvements/Rights43Proposal/filtersExpanded.png

What do you think? Could this filters be helpful? Are too powerful/complex/useless?

From an implementation point of view, can a livetable have more than one filter per a column. Anyway this will be a custom livetable, because we also need to integrate the "add user" part and the "save/reset" buttons.

Also, from an implementation point of view, should we enable multiselect (ex. to select multiple rights)?

Obs. Right -> Sources -> Implicit refer to the rights that come from the setting of another right (example: admin means implicit view+edit+delete+comment; creator means implicit delete). Would this filter option be useful or it is too much?

Thanks, Caty

WDYT ?

Thanks, Caty